UPDATED: Two Houses Destroyed In Leamington Fire

Two houses were destroyed after a fire Saturday afternoon in the 400 block of Robson Road in Leamington.

The fire broke out around 1:30pm, and took crews several hours to bring it under control.

In addition to the two homes, two out buildings, three cars, and one motorcycle are a total loss.

Two adults suffered minor injuries, and are now staying with family along with their dog.

Damage is estimated at $375,000.  One house was vacant.

The cause will go down as undetermined.
